Mangrove tours Manuel Antonio / Manuel Antonio Experiences
Embark on a thrilling nighttime boat tour through the mystical mangroves of Manuel Antonio, where the shimmering water reflects the faint moonlight and the surrounding wilderness looms silently in the darkness. This immersive experience offers travel adventurers a soul-stirring glimpse into the mysterious nocturnal ecosystem, invoking awe and wonder as you glide silently beneath the starry sky, enveloped by the wild beauty and peaceful solitude of Costa Rica’s hidden natural paradise. Feel the cool night breeze, listen to gentle water ripples, and let this unique journey awaken your spirit of discovery.
